Event Description
Device report from synthes reports an event in japan as follows: it was reported the patient underwent an open reduction internal fixation (orif) surgery for a zygomatic fracture on (b)(6) 2023.During the surgery, the tap broke and a piece of it remained in the patient.The patient¿s bone quality was noted to be hard.The surgery was completed successfully with a thirty (30) minute delay.The next day, (b)(6) 2023, the patient underwent a reoperation to remove the broken fragment.The patient outcome/status was reported as stable.This report is for a tap.This is report 1 of 1 for (b)(4).

Manufacturer Narrative
Depuy synthes is submitting this report pursuant to the provisions of 21 cfr, part 803.This report may be based on information which depuy synthes has not been able to investigate or verify prior to the required reporting date.This report does not reflect a conclusion by fda, depuy synthes or its employees that the report constitutes an admission that the device, depuy synthes, or its employees caused or contributed to the potential event described in this report.Review of the device history record(s) showed that there were no issues during the manufacture of this product, and any sub-components, which would contribute to this complaint condition.311.032 synthes lot # 9832083, supplier lot # n/a, release to warehouse date: 01 feb 2016, manufactured by: synthes monument, no ncrs were generated during production.The product was returned to depuy synthes for evaluation.The depuy synthes team conducted a visual inspection of the returned device.Visual analysis of the returned device found that the tap f/resorbcortexscr ø1.5 self-drill l6 was broken from the tip, the broken fragment was not returned for evaluation.A dimensional inspection for the tap f/resorbcortexscr ø1.5 self-drill l6 was unable to be performed due to post manufacturing damage.The observed condition of the device was consistent with a random component failure that may have been caused by exposure to unintended forces.As part of depuy synthes quality process, all devices are manufactured, inspected, and released to approved specifications.The overall complaint was confirmed as the observed condition of the tap f/resorbcortexscr ø1.5 self-drill l6 would contribute to the complained device issue.There is no indication that a design or manufacturing issue has caused the complaint condition and hence the root cause cannot be determined.Based on the investigation findings, it has been determined that no corrective and/or preventative action is proposed.Additional monitoring for any potential safety signals will be conducted through complaint trending and other post-market safety surveillance activities.If information is obtained that was not available for this medwatch, a follow-up medwatch will be filed as appropriate.
